Announcement to all SAMVOZA leaders and groups.

Message from Vice Chairman Veteran Godfrey Giles

SAMVOZA has identified many MilVets who are in desperate need of assistance, over and above MilVets fighting for DMV benefits that can take many months before approved. Many MilVets are in desperate immediate need for basic food (WVVoice.org), accommodation, healthcare and medication. SAMVOZA decided to identify MilVets who need urgent help and to begin campaigns to assist these MilVets. The BackaBuddy.co.za platform is an excellent platform  and very fitting for SAMVOZA to assist MilVets in need.

 

Who is BackaBuddy?

They are Africa's most trusted crowdfunding platform for causes ranging from healthcare to disaster relief. Since 2015, they have raised over R550 million from 500,000 global donors for over 44,000 causes.

You can create campaigns for anything that has a positive impact on individuals, communities, and the environment.

 

These campaigns can raise funds for organisations or for individuals who need donations for a variety of reasons, including medical procedures, sporting opportunities, or for studies. You can even create campaigns in loving memory of a special person to raise funds for his or her favourite cause.

SAMVOZA has already started the first campaign

Coastal Radio in South Africa recently interviewed SAMVOZA Vice Chairman, Veteran Godfrey Giles, to talk about the matter of unpaid and overdue veterans' benefits in South Africa and what is being done by Veteran Organizations, like the CMVO and SAMVOZA, to address and resolve this problem through the judicial system.  Enquiries relating this matter email info@samvoza.org

SAMVOZA - Kids for Flips - Suid-Kaap Forum / Just Love

Outreach to Stilbaai in December 2015

On Sunday 27 and Monday the 28th of December a 104 less privilege children from Melkhoutfontein, Stilbaai and surrounding farms had the opportunity to fly in Little Annie.
This outreach from Just Love Mission was made possible by the Mission itself and the South African Military Veterans Organization International (SAMVOINT).

SAMVOZA - Kit for kids at Laerskool Bertie Barnard

Bertie Barnard Primary School is in the Stilbaai area of the Western Cape and educates many young children from low socio-economic backgrounds. These children love their sport, so Colin Bowring of SAMVOZA helped sponsor the rugby and netball teams with new school outfits.

Veteran Richard Southey MMM_edited.jpg
SAMVOZA - Laerskool Bertie Barnard Project

In December, 2016, SAMVOZA Volunteers refurbish the Administration Offices of the Bertie Barnard Primary School in Stilbaai, Western Cape.

The end result was a completely new look and a school reception that gives a very good impression
and family atmosphere that clearly shows this school’s commitment to its pupils.

SAMVOZA Remote Community Upliftment Project

Remote areas of Africa have issues with finding a clean water supply. This projects flies in equipment required to find water, drill for it and pump it out. What better way than using a Merry-go-Round, driven by the children?

SAMVOZA Malmesbury Shelter Project

The project started with improving the shelter situation for 36 Veterans and their families in the Malmesbury area in the Western Cape. Yongama Zigebe, our Welfare and Parliamentary Officer put the entire project together, securing a roof over the heads of this large number of homeless Veterans and their families and food on the table.

The shelter is an old Church building, which Yongama had to make a personal commitment to ensure it will be looked after.

We, the Veterans and, we are sure the people within that Shelter, salute you, Yongama.

SAMVOZA Safe House Project

This project provides a safe haven for destitute Veterans and their families, putting them up until they can find their feet again in a safe family environment. This enables the Veteran to reestablish himself / herself in suitable work whilst the children can attend school.
